A copper-alloy Nummus of the House of Theodosius. Mint is Rome, 388-402, Reece period 21. Obverse is illegible. Obverse legend is illegible. Reverse shows Victory advancing left, holding trophy and dragging captive, / //RE and reverse legend reads SALVS REI PVBLICAE. Weight is 1.19g and diameter is 12.20mm. See LRBC p.62, 796 passim.
